Smart Weather Condition Sensors
Smart climate sensors have actually reinvented the efficiency of contemporary irrigation systems by readjusting watering timetables based upon real-time ecological data. These sensing units check variables such as temperature level, moisture, wind speed, and solar radiation, enabling systems to react dynamically to transforming weather. By integrating this information, wise sensors can maximize water use, reducing waste and making sure that landscapes obtain the suitable amount of wetness. This technology not only preserves water however likewise promotes much healthier plant development by stopping overwatering or underwatering. Soil Moisture Sensors
Dirt wetness sensing units play a crucial duty in modern watering systems, providing real-time information that enhances water efficiency. These gadgets gauge the volumetric water content in the dirt, permitting specific evaluations of wetness degrees. By integrating dirt moisture sensors into irrigation systems, customers can avoid overwatering or underwatering, eventually advertising much healthier plant development and preserving water resources.The sensing units transmit information to controllers, which can readjust sprinkling routines based upon existing dirt conditions. This data-driven approach lessens water waste and warranties that plants obtain the best quantity of visit this website moisture.
